Ski
The WayBack prefers an adventure to a rustic hut over the crowds of busy resorts. A superlight wood core with a Carbon Web makes this adventure ski one of the lightest mid-fats on the market. It excels at long approaches and pays increasingly greater dividends the farther one ventures into the mountains. The All-Terrain shovel rocker combined with the shallow, progressive sidecut makes it ultra-predictable in high-alpine conditions, with the added benefit of rocker that also makes trailbreaking easier.
Binding
The new Eagle 10, has been improved to give a wider support of the front hinge, wider contact area at the heel, a new climbing aid and new ski brake. With new Eagle 10 walking and ascending is more natural and safer than ever before – even under extreme conditions. The secret is the Diamir Gliding Technology. This binding achieves what no other has managed to do up to now: it combines maximum walking comfort and stability without the slightest compromise on safety.The Diamir Eagle offers an active safety release, because the binding is equipped with a rotating toe piece including a separate spring assembly. This meets the standards of a high-end alpine binding. The long elasticity and restoring forces of the springs reduce the risk of unintentional releases to a minimum. This is very important, particularly on uneven ground and in deep snow. Diamir binding systems are TÜV certified and fulfil the DIN ISO norms for touring and alpine bindings, as well as for touring ski boots and alpine ski boots.
